¿Qué hay de nuevo en msxml 4.0?
Nuevas características en Microsoft XMLCORSERVICES (MSXML) Versión 4.0 lanzado en septiembre de 2001
Microsoft Corporation
Octubre de 2001
Descargue MSXML4.0 con la URL MSDNNOWDOGS (inglés).
Resumen: Este artículo se centra en nuevas características y cambios importantes en Microsoft XMLCoreservices (MSXML) versión 4.0 lanzada en septiembre de 2001 en comparación con la versión 3.0.
Tabla de contenido
Introducción
Nuevas características
Función paralela y eliminar modos alternativos
Nota importante
Introducción
El primer cambio que notará es el nuevo nombre completo oficial de MSXML. Al principio, MSXML era un componente que proporciona análisis XML, por lo que su nombre completo era Microsoft® XMLParser. XML y MSXML evolucionan constantemente con el tiempo. Ahora MSXML proporciona mucho más que análisis. El nombre ha cambiado desde el lanzamiento de la versión 3.0, y ahora se puede decir que está hecho. El nuevo nombre, Microsoft® XMLCoreServices, ilustra completamente las nuevas características proporcionadas por este componente. Tenga en cuenta que la abreviatura del nombre sigue siendo la misma que antes: msxml.
Microsoft XMLCORSERVICES (MSXML) Versión 4.0 lanzado en septiembre de 2001 es el lanzamiento oficial de MSXML4.0. Este lanzamiento ofrece muchas características nuevas importantes, así como algunos cambios importantes, especialmente características paralelas. MSXML4.0 también proporciona soluciones a problemas conocidos; Se han realizado mejoras en términos de rendimiento, consistencia y documentación y proporciona ejemplos adicionales.
En comparación con la versión 3.0, las mejoras y las funciones adicionales proporcionadas por MSXML4.0 incluyen principalmente los siguientes tres aspectos:
Apoyo extendido para la última recomendación de XMLSChema (XSD) WorldwideWebConsortium (W3C).
Grandes mejoras de rendimiento.
Basado en el simpleapiforXML estándar real (SAX2), el soporte extendido para estructuras de procesamiento XML continuas.
Otro gran cambio es la eliminación de patrones alternativos. MSXML versión 4.0 y las versiones posteriores se instalarán estrictamente en modo paralelo. Esto significa que los progids independientes de la versión ya no serán compatibles, y las versiones existentes de Microsoft® Internet Explorer no podrán usar MSXML4.0 automáticamente si no hay script. La razón de este cambio es que, según los comentarios de los clientes, las versiones independientes de los Progids pueden crear muchos problemas al mantener aplicaciones utilizando MSXML versión 2.6 y versiones posteriores.
El objeto ServerXMLHTTPRequest lanzado en MSXML3.0 proporciona acceso HTTP del lado del servidor confiable (independiente de Wininet). La función de pila HTTP del lado del servidor ahora incluye el nuevo componente WinHTTP5.0 (lanzado con la instalación MSXML4.0). Serverxmlhttprequest solo proporciona un front-end para este componente.